Conga Nabs Two Awards From Aragon Research

Company named “Hot Vendor” in Workflow and Content Automation, CIO Praniti Lakhwara honored for outstanding leadership

Conga, the leader in digital transformation for commercial operations, today announced that Aragon Research, Inc. has recognized the company and its Chief Information Officer Praniti Lakhwara for two awards. Aragon included Conga in the list of “Hot Vendors” in its Workflow and Content Automation (WCA) report 2020 and named Lakhwara as an outstanding female leader and CIO for this year’s Women in Technology Awards.

Aragon presented the awards to Conga at Aragon Transform, an annual event and awards ceremony that recognizes Hot Vendors, Innovators, and Women in Tech award winners.

Vendors selected for “Hot Vendor” report are noteworthy, visionary and innovative
Aragon’s Hot Vendors in Workflow and Content Automation, 2020 explores how WCA is positioned to challenge legacy technology applications, such as standalone Customer Communications Management. Conga was one of four vendors identified in the report.

Conga’s Digital Document Transformation Suite accelerates revenue by digitizing the documents and automating the processes for customer engagement, pricing, quoting, contracting, and revenue management. Conga Composer, part of Conga’s Digital Document Transformation Suite, enables Salesforce customers to customize, streamline and scale document generation and reporting for unlimited use cases across all organizations and industries.

Women in Tech Awards celebrate outstanding female professionals
Aragon’s Women in Tech Awards recognize achievements of women who have demonstrated outstanding personal and professional growth and significantly contributed to the technology industry. Lakhwara, who has served as Conga’s CIO since 2017, is responsible for IT solutions and the company’s internal security program. She is driving a comprehensive strategy that will build a world class IT organization, deliver innovative solutions globally, and create a secure robust infrastructure for Conga’s customers.
